Compartir a través de


ViewUserControl<TModel> Clase

Definición

Representa la información necesaria para crear un control de usuario fuertemente tipado.

public class ViewUserControl<TModel> : System.Web.Mvc.ViewUserControl
type ViewUserControl<'Model> = class
    inherit ViewUserControl
Public Class ViewUserControl(Of TModel)
Inherits ViewUserControl

Parámetros de tipo

TModel

Tipo del modelo.

Herencia
ViewUserControl<TModel>
Derivado

Constructores

ViewUserControl<TModel>()

Inicializa una nueva instancia de la clase ViewUserControl<TModel>.

Propiedades

Ajax

Obtiene el script AJAX para la vista.

Html

Obtiene el HTML de la vista.

Model

Obtiene el modelo.

TempData

Obtiene el diccionario de datos temporales.

(Heredado de ViewUserControl)
Url

Obtiene la dirección URL de la vista.

(Heredado de ViewUserControl)
ViewBag

Obtiene el contenedor de la vista.

(Heredado de ViewUserControl)
ViewContext

Obtiene o establece el contexto de la vista.

(Heredado de ViewUserControl)
ViewData

Obtiene o establece los datos de la vista.

ViewDataKey

Obtiene o establece la clave de datos de la vista.

(Heredado de ViewUserControl)
Writer

Obtiene el sistema de escritura que se usa para representar la vista para la respuesta.

(Heredado de ViewUserControl)

Métodos

EnsureViewData()

Garantiza que los datos de vista se agregan al ViewDataDictionary objeto del control de usuario si existen los datos de vista.

(Heredado de ViewUserControl)
RenderView(ViewContext)

Representa la vista mediante el contexto de vista especificado.

(Heredado de ViewUserControl)
SetTextWriter(TextWriter)
Obsoletos.

Establece el escritor de texto que se usa para representar la vista para la respuesta.

(Heredado de ViewUserControl)
SetViewData(ViewDataDictionary)

Establece los datos de vista para la vista.

Se aplica a